Smart watches

2 min read

Smart watches are a relatively new market, but it is already booming with plenty of brands offering their own take on the product.

Two companies that have really raised the alarm for the other brands are Michael Kors and Fossil. These two designer brands have created watches women want to wear. They aren’t fitness devices… the fashion accessories.

Michael Kors ‘Access Bradshaw’ Rose Gold watch is stunning to look at… you’d never guess it was a smart watch from the case… but it’s packed with clever features, like Social Media Updating, text and email notifications, App Notifications, Fitness Tracking, Voice-Activated Google and more.

Take a look at the Access Bradshaw by Michael Kors. It’s a classic beauty and filled with today’s best technology.

There’s nothing archaic about Fossil Watches new range. The Fossil Q Wander Watch will definitely get people’s attention. Wear this at a meeting or at a café with friends, and it will not go unnoticed. The stylish rose gold stainless steel case is fitted with a leather strap.

With a touchscreen display, this watch packs the power you need to efficiently accomplish all your daily tasks in a smaller, sleeker package.
